About the role

We are seeking a Finance & Strategy team member to drive two of the most consequential financial workstreams at Anthropic: Model Monetization and Enterprise & Verticals. On one side, you'll own the economics behind how we price and package — spanning list pricing, tiering, and consumption mechanics across our model families. On the other, you'll serve as the Finance & Strategy partner to our Enterprise and Verticals product teams — shaping the business cases, product economics, and investment decisions behind what we build for enterprises and priority industries. Together, these determine how the business world accesses frontier AI..

This is a high-ownership, high-autonomy role for someone who genuinely loves to model and is energized by hard, ambiguous questions. You'll connect token economics, inference and compute costs, and margin to pricing and packaging decisions, and bring that same rigor to enterprise and vertical product investments. We're looking for someone opinionated and decisive, you'll be expected to form a view, defend it with rigorous analysis, and drive it to a decision. A deep, current obsession with AI and a perspective on where the field is heading will make you far more effective here.

If you are passionate about applying financial rigor to the economics of frontier AI, join us in making AI safe and impactful.

Key responsibilities
  • Own model monetization end to end: build and maintain the financial models that connect token economics, inference and compute costs, and margin to pricing and packaging decisions across our model family and API

  • Serve as the Finance & Strategy partner to our Enterprise and Verticals product teams, owning the financial lens on what we build for enterprises and priority industries

  • Build the business cases behind enterprise and vertical product investments: size opportunities, model product economics and pricing, and evaluate the return on competing roadmap bets

  • Partner cross-functionally with product, go-to-market, and compute stakeholders to evaluate pricing and packaging changes, new model launches, and consumption-based offerings, translating analysis into clear, opinionated recommendations

  • Analyze the drivers of unit economics and gross margin, surfacing the trends, risks, and opportunities that should inform monetization and product strategy

  • Track the competitive and market landscape for AI monetization and enterprise adoption, bringing an outside-in view that sharpens our own strategy

  • Form and defend a point of view on monetization and product investment decisions, delivering clear, concise analyses that drive to resolution with executives and cross-functional partners

  • Collaborate with finance, FP&A, and accounting counterparts to ensure decisions are consistent with broader financial strategy and reporting

  • Establish and maintain reporting dashboards that track key pricing, margin, consumption, and product performance metrics

How we're different

We believe that the highest-impact AI research will be big science. At Anthropic we work as a single cohesive team on just a few large-scale research efforts. And we value impact — advancing our long-term goals of steerable, trustworthy AI — rather than work on smaller and more specific puzzles. We view AI research as an empirical science, which has as much in common with physics and biology as with traditional efforts in computer science. We're an extremely collaborative group, and we host frequent research discussions to ensure that we are pursuing the highest-impact work at any given time. As such, we greatly value communication skills.

The easiest way to understand our research directions is to read our recent research. This research continues many of the directions our team worked on prior to Anthropic, including: GPT-3, Circuit-Based Interpretability, Multimodal Neurons, Scaling Laws, AI & Compute, Concrete Problems in AI Safety, and Learning from Human Preferences.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
